Automotive Mechanic Jobs in North Dakota
An Automotive Mechanic is a vital part of the automotive industry, responsible for diagnosing, repairing, and maintaining diverse types of vehicles. They inspect vehicle engines and mechanical/electrical components to diagnose issues accurately. Their duties also include conducting routine maintenance work such as replacing fluids, oil changes, checking tire pressure, and more. Additionally, they may repair or replace broken or dysfunctional parts and fix vehicle issues like leaks, worn out parts, and potentially failed inspections. They need to be familiar with vehicle diagnostic equipment and ready to keep up-to-date with current technologies and techniques.
Key skills for an Automotive Mechanic include excellent problem-solving abilities, physical strength and dexterity, strong customer service skills, and thorough knowledge of mechanical and electronic components of vehicles. They should ideally possess certification in Automotive Service Excellence (ASE). This certification verifies the mechanic's technical knowledge and practical experience. Before becoming a full-fledged Automotive Mechanic, a person may work as a Junior Mechanic, an Automotive Technician, or an Apprentice Mechanic, gaining the necessary skills and experience under the guidance of seasoned professionals.
